Anomaloppia dispariseta Hammer 1958
Description
Anomaloppia dispariseta (Hammer, 1958)
Specimens examined: LLao LLao - under N. dombeyi, leaf litter XI-2006 (5), soil XI-2006 (2), Cerro P. Laguna - under N. antarctica, soil XI-2006 (10).
Remarks: Originally described from Argentina. Previously reported in Argentina [as Oppia dispariseta Hammer] in the province of Mendoza and in the Falkland Islands (Starý & Block 1996). First record for the province of Río Negro.
